Output aeb0596b2d7fc80259e60628d2e9193aa7c752703906a07e510463081ecde7e3:0

value
3504403880
script pubkey
OP_0 OP_PUSHBYTES_20 85d0b41c4eb5dbc6ef332642ea62af591a5fc052
address
tb1qshgtg8zwkhdudmenyepw5c40tyd9lszjr3n580
transaction
aeb0596b2d7fc80259e60628d2e9193aa7c752703906a07e510463081ecde7e3